Download e-book for iPad: Beginning POJOs: Lightweight Java Web Development Using by Brian Sam-Bodden

By Brian Sam-Bodden

ISBN-10: 1590595963

ISBN-13: 9781590595961

Starting POJOs introduces you to open resource light-weight net improvement utilizing simple previous Java gadgets (POJOs) and the instruments and frameworks that let this. Tier by means of tier, this ebook courses you thru the development of complicated yet light-weight company Java-based net purposes. Such purposes are headquartered round numerous significant open resource light-weight frameworks, together with Spring, Hibernate, Tapestry, and JBoss. extra help comes from the main profitable and normal open-source instruments: Eclipse and Ant, and the more and more well known TestNG. This publication is perfect if you are new to open resource and light-weight Java.

Show description

Read Online or Download Beginning POJOs: Lightweight Java Web Development Using Plain Old Java Objects in Spring, Hibernate and Tapestry PDF

Best introductory & beginning books

Introduction to the Theory of Programming Languages - download pdf or read online

The layout and implementation of programming languages, from Fortran and Cobol to Caml and Java, has been one of many key advancements within the administration of ever extra advanced automated platforms. advent to the idea of Programming Languages supplies the reader the potential to find the instruments to imagine, layout, and enforce those languages.

New PDF release: Computers and Art (2008)

Desktops and Art offers insightful views at the use of the pc as a device for artists. The ways taken range from its historic, philosophical and useful implications to using computing device know-how in paintings perform. The individuals comprise an artwork critic, an educator, a training artist and a researcher.

Introduction to Parallel Programming - download pdf or read online

Contents: Preface; advent; Tiny Fortran; and working method versions; techniques, Shared reminiscence and easy Parallel courses; easy Parallel Programming strategies; limitations and Race stipulations; creation to Scheduling-Nested Loops; Overcoming information Dependencies; Scheduling precis; Linear Recurrence Relations--Backward Dependencies; functionality Tuning; Discrete occasion, Discrete Time Simulation; a few functions; Semaphores and occasions; Programming undertaking.

Martin Frost's Learning WML, and WMLScript PDF

В книге рассказывается о технологии WML, которая позволяет создавать WAP страницы. И если Вас интересует WAP «изнутри», то эта книга для Вас. e-book Description the subsequent iteration of cellular communicators is the following, and offering content material to them will suggest programming in WML (Wireless Markup Language) and WMLScript, the languages of the instant program atmosphere (WAE).

Extra info for Beginning POJOs: Lightweight Java Web Development Using Plain Old Java Objects in Spring, Hibernate and Tapestry

Example text

The message flow of a sequence diagram matches the narrative of the corresponding use case. Sequence diagrams are an excellent way to document use case scenarios and refine and synchronize a use case diagram with respect to a domain model. A sequence diagram typically shows a user or actor and the object and components they interact with in the context of a use case execution. Whenever necessary, I use sequence diagrams in the book to refine and validate a use case against the application’s domain model.

Although CVS is the prevailing version control system, there are other very popular systems available. In the open source category, a system that’s winning many converts is Subversion, which is touted as the most likely replacement for CVS on most large open source projects. There are plug-ins for Subversion, and for most of the other open source and commercial version control systems, and most are modeled after CVS plug-ins, which should make for an easy transition. Database Plug-ins A great portion of the time testing a database-driven Web application is spent checking the contents of a relational database.

Applications will be accessed remotely via the Internet using a browser-based interface. • The conference internal network will be protected with an HTTP firewall. • A large percentage of attendees carry network-ready PDAs or other mobile computing devices. fm Page 11 Wednesday, February 22, 2006 6:01 AM CHAPTER 1 ■ INTRODUCTION Open Issues It’s expected that as the system is designed and developed, your understanding about the dynamics governing its behavior will coalesce. New relationships and interfaces will be discovered, and previously unidentified usage scenarios will appear.

Download PDF sample

Beginning POJOs: Lightweight Java Web Development Using Plain Old Java Objects in Spring, Hibernate and Tapestry by Brian Sam-Bodden

by Kevin

Rated 4.15 of 5 – based on 46 votes